The utility model discloses a vibrating screen. The key point of the technical scheme is to include a screen box, vibrating legs are arranged under the screen box, and multi-layer screens for screening materials are arranged inside the screen box. The box is provided with a cleaning brush above the sieve, and the cleaning brush is slidably connected with the sieve box. The utility model improves the working efficiency of the vibrating screen in the prior art.

背景技术Background technique

振动筛的应用十分广泛,从采矿、冶金、煤炭、石油化工,到水利电力、轻工、建筑、交通运输,甚至是面粉加工等等,可以说,我们生活的方方面面都离不开振动筛分机械。在传统工艺流程中,使用的设备缺点有:能耗高,噪音大,粉尘污染严重;使用周期短,磨损严重,维修不方便,检修周期较长,筛选效果不是很好,工作效率低等问题。Vibrating screens are widely used, from mining, metallurgy, coal, petrochemical, to water conservancy and electricity, light industry, construction, transportation, and even flour processing, etc. It can be said that every aspect of our life is inseparable from vibrating screening mechanical. In the traditional process, the disadvantages of the equipment used are: high energy consumption, high noise, serious dust pollution; short service life, serious wear, inconvenient maintenance, long maintenance period, poor screening effect, low work efficiency, etc. .

为解决上述技术问题,现有技术中,申请公布号为CN105127097A的中国发明专利申请文件中公开了一种振动筛,包括筛箱,所述筛箱内设有用以筛分物料的筛网,所述筛网设有依次布置进行分级筛选物料的多层,在所述筛箱内还设有直接带动所述筛网振动的激振装置,所述激振装置包括两个同步旋转的振动电机,所述筛箱外设有起减振支撑作用的支腿,所述支腿支撑连接于设在所述筛箱中部的连接横梁上。In order to solve the above-mentioned technical problems, in the prior art, a Chinese invention patent application document with the application publication number CN105127097A discloses a vibrating screen, including a screen box, and a screen for screening materials is arranged in the screen box. The screen is provided with multiple layers arranged in sequence for grading and screening materials, and an excitation device that directly drives the vibration of the screen is provided in the screen box. The excitation device includes two synchronously rotating vibration motors, The outside of the screen box is provided with outriggers that act as vibration-damping supports, and the outriggers are supported and connected to a connecting crossbeam arranged in the middle of the screen box.

现有技术中的振动筛中的筛网常常会被堵塞,造成筛网无法完成筛分的工作,需要将多层筛网拆卸后进行清洁才能正常运行,此种方式大大降低了振动筛的工作效率。The screen in the vibrating screen in the prior art is often blocked, causing the screen to be unable to complete the screening work. It is necessary to disassemble the multi-layer screen and clean it before it can run normally. This method greatly reduces the work of the vibrating screen. efficiency.

实用新型内容Utility model content

针对现有技术存在的不足,本实用新型的目的在于提供一种振动筛,提高现有技术中的振动筛的工作效率。Aiming at the deficiencies in the prior art, the purpose of the utility model is to provide a vibrating screen to improve the working efficiency of the vibrating screen in the prior art.

为实现上述目的,本实用新型提供了如下技术方案:一种振动筛,包括筛箱,所述筛箱下方设有振动支腿,所述筛箱内设有用以筛分物料的多层筛网,所述筛箱在筛网上方设有清洁刷,所述清洁刷与筛箱滑移连接。In order to achieve the above purpose, the utility model provides the following technical solutions: a vibrating screen, including a screen box, vibrating legs are arranged under the screen box, and multi-layer screens for screening materials are arranged inside the screen box , the screen box is provided with a cleaning brush above the screen, and the cleaning brush is connected to the screen box by sliding.

通过采用上述技术方案,可直接通过清洁刷对筛网进行清洁,无需拆卸滤网,此种清洁方式提高了振动筛的工作效率。By adopting the above technical solution, the screen mesh can be cleaned directly by the cleaning brush without disassembling the filter mesh. This cleaning method improves the working efficiency of the vibrating screen.

本实用新型进一步设置为:所述筛箱的侧壁设有供清洁刷沿侧壁滑移的滑槽。The utility model is further configured as follows: the side wall of the screen box is provided with a chute for the cleaning brush to slide along the side wall.

通过采用上述技术方案,清洁刷沿筛箱侧壁滑移的连接方式使清洁刷的运动精确并有效的与筛网接触。By adopting the above technical solution, the connection mode in which the cleaning brush slides along the side wall of the screen box enables the movement of the cleaning brush to contact the screen mesh accurately and effectively.

本实用新型进一步设置为:所述筛箱在滑槽的上方设有放置清洁刷的收纳槽,所述收纳槽与滑槽相互连通。The utility model is further configured as follows: the sieve box is provided with a storage groove for placing cleaning brushes above the chute, and the storage groove and the chute are connected to each other.

通过采用上述技术方案,收纳槽在振动筛工作时可将清洁刷抬高,使清洁刷下端脱离筛网,避免清洁刷影响物料向出料斗方向流动。By adopting the above technical solution, the storage tank can raise the cleaning brush when the vibrating screen is working, so that the lower end of the cleaning brush is separated from the screen, so as to prevent the cleaning brush from affecting the flow of materials toward the discharge hopper.

本实用新型进一步设置为:所述筛箱设有可封闭滑槽的挡料板。The utility model is further configured as follows: the screen box is provided with a material blocking plate that can close the chute.

通过采用上述技术方案,挡料板可防止振动筛工作过程中物料从滑槽内流出。By adopting the above technical solution, the material blocking plate can prevent the material from flowing out of the chute during the working process of the vibrating screen.

本实用新型进一步设置为:所述挡料板与筛箱通过扭簧合页连接。The utility model is further configured as: the material blocking plate is connected with the screen box through a torsion spring hinge.

通过采用上述技术方案,扭簧合页的连接方法使挡料板可保持水平或竖直状态。By adopting the above technical solution, the connection method of the torsion spring hinge enables the material baffle to maintain a horizontal or vertical state.

本实用新型进一步设置为:所述振动支腿与所述筛箱的连接处设有振动弹簧。The utility model is further configured as: a vibration spring is provided at the connection between the vibration leg and the screen box.

通过采用上述技术方案,振动弹簧可使振动筛的震动平缓,避免破坏振动筛的零部件和产生较大的噪音污染。By adopting the above technical proposal, the vibrating spring can make the vibration of the vibrating screen smooth, avoiding damage to parts of the vibrating screen and generating large noise pollution.

本实用新型进一步设置为:所述清洁刷的两端设有阻止清洁刷滑出滑槽的挡块,且挡块位于滑槽的外侧。The utility model is further configured as follows: the two ends of the cleaning brush are provided with stoppers to prevent the cleaning brush from sliding out of the chute, and the stoppers are located outside the chute.

通过采用上述技术方案,挡块一方面可防止清洁刷滑出滑槽,另一方面可方便操作者滑动清洁刷。By adopting the above technical solution, the stop block can prevent the cleaning brush from slipping out of the chute on the one hand, and on the other hand can facilitate the operator to slide the cleaning brush.

本实用新型进一步设置为:所述挡块与清洁刷为可拆卸连接。The utility model is further configured as: the block is detachably connected to the cleaning brush.

通过采用上述技术方案,当清洁刷磨损时可将清洁刷两端的挡块拆下更换新的清洁刷。By adopting the above technical scheme, when the cleaning brush wears out, the stoppers at both ends of the cleaning brush can be removed and replaced with new cleaning brushes.

本实用新型进一步设置为:所述挡块与清洁刷插接。The utility model is further configured as: the stopper is plugged with the cleaning brush.

通过采用上述技术方案,插接的连接方式使连接结构简单易操作。By adopting the above technical solution, the plug-in connection mode makes the connection structure simple and easy to operate.

综上所述,本实用新型具有以下有益效果:1.本实用新型可直接通过清洁刷对筛网进行清洁,无需拆卸滤网,此种清洁方式提高了振动筛的工作效率;2.本实用新型的清洁刷不仅可以用来清除筛网中的杂质,还可以用来清洁筛网;3.本实用新型的清洁刷磨损后可方便更换。In summary, the utility model has the following beneficial effects: 1. The utility model can directly clean the screen through the cleaning brush without disassembling the filter. This cleaning method improves the working efficiency of the vibrating screen; 2. The utility model The new type of cleaning brush can not only be used to remove impurities in the screen, but also can be used to clean the screen; 3. The cleaning brush of the utility model can be easily replaced after being worn out.

具体实施方式Detailed ways

下面结合附图对本实用新型作进一步详细说明。Below in conjunction with accompanying drawing, the utility model is described in further detail.

实施例:一种振动筛,如附图1所示,包括机架1和筛箱3,机架1和筛箱3之间设有竖直的振动支腿11,振动支腿11与筛箱3之间连接有竖直的震动弹簧12,机架1在筛箱3的右端设有竖直的振动电机2,振动电机2与筛箱3的底部连接;筛箱3的竖直方向设有两层水平的筛网31,且上层筛网31的目数小于下层筛网31的目数,筛箱3的左端对应于两个筛网31和箱底的位置设有三个方向交错的出料斗33,筛箱3分别在两个筛网31和箱底上端设有一个清洁刷32。Embodiment: A kind of vibrating screen, as shown in accompanying drawing 1, comprises frame 1 and screen box 3, is provided with vertical vibrating support leg 11 between frame 1 and screen box 3, and vibrating support leg 11 is connected with screen box 3 is connected with a vertical vibration spring 12, and the frame 1 is provided with a vertical vibration motor 2 at the right end of the screen box 3, and the vibration motor 2 is connected with the bottom of the screen box 3; the vertical direction of the screen box 3 is provided with Two layers of horizontal screens 31, and the mesh number of the upper screen 31 is smaller than that of the lower screen 31, and the left end of the screen box 3 is provided with a staggered discharge hopper 33 in three directions corresponding to the positions of the two screens 31 and the bottom of the box , The screen box 3 is respectively provided with a cleaning brush 32 at the upper end of the two screens 31 and the bottom of the box.

如附图2所示,清洁刷32两端分别设有一个挡块321,挡块321的一侧开设有凹槽,清洁刷32的两端分别与两个挡块321通过凹槽插接。As shown in Figure 2, two ends of the cleaning brush 32 are respectively provided with a stopper 321, and one side of the stopper 321 is provided with a groove, and the two ends of the cleaning brush 32 are respectively inserted into the two stoppers 321 through the groove.

如附图3所示,筛箱3的左右两个设有对称的水平滑槽34,清洁刷32的两端与滑槽34滑移连接,且清洁刷32两端连接的挡块321位于滑槽34外侧,滑槽34靠近筛箱3右侧的一端的上方设有收纳槽35,收纳槽35的高度大于清洁刷32的高度,收纳槽35的上端与滑槽34之间通过滑道连通,清洁刷32可放置在收纳槽35内;滑槽34下方的筛箱3外侧设有可封闭滑槽34的挡料板,挡料板下端与筛箱3连接且挡料板右上方开设有凹槽,防止与放置在收纳槽35内的清洁刷32发上干涉。As shown in accompanying drawing 3, the left and right sides of the screen box 3 are provided with symmetrical horizontal chute 34, and the two ends of the cleaning brush 32 are slidingly connected with the chute 34, and the stoppers 321 connected to the two ends of the cleaning brush 32 are positioned on the sliding chute. Outboard of groove 34, chute 34 is provided with storage groove 35 near the top of one end on the right side of screen box 3, and the height of storage groove 35 is greater than the height of cleaning brush 32, and the upper end of storage groove 35 and chute 34 are communicated by slideway , the cleaning brush 32 can be placed in the storage tank 35; the outside of the sieve box 3 below the chute 34 is provided with a baffle plate that can close the chute 34, the lower end of the baffle plate is connected with the sieve box 3 and the top right of the baffle plate is provided with a The groove prevents interference with the cleaning brush 32 placed in the receiving groove 35 .

如附图4所示,挡料板下侧的左右两端分别与筛箱3通过扭簧合页361连接(参照图3)。As shown in Figure 4, the left and right ends of the underside of the baffle plate are respectively connected to the screen box 3 through torsion spring hinges 361 (refer to Figure 3).

该振动筛的工作原理如下:将三个清洁刷32都放置在收纳槽35内,关闭挡料板,启动振动电机2,从筛箱3的右上方向筛箱3中加料,物料经右端上下震动的筛箱3的作用,筛选好的物料分别经左端的三个出料斗33流出,工作一段时间后,当发现筛网31有堵塞时,停止向筛箱3中加料,待筛箱3中的物料全部流出时,关闭振动电机2,打开挡料板使其处于水平位置,将清洁刷32从收纳槽35中沿滑道滑移到滑槽34内,然后沿着滑槽34左右滑动清洁刷32,便可将筛网31中堵塞的杂质刷出来,清洁完毕后,重复以上操作。The working principle of the vibrating screen is as follows: put the three cleaning brushes 32 in the storage tank 35, close the baffle plate, start the vibrating motor 2, feed material into the screen box 3 from the upper right side of the screen box 3, and the material vibrates up and down through the right end The function of screen box 3 is that the screened materials flow out through the three discharge hoppers 33 at the left end respectively. After working for a period of time, when the screen mesh 31 is found to be blocked, stop feeding to the screen box 3 and wait for the material in the screen box 3 When all the materials flow out, turn off the vibration motor 2, open the baffle plate to make it in a horizontal position, slide the cleaning brush 32 from the storage tank 35 into the chute 34 along the slideway, and then slide the cleaning brush left and right along the chute 34 32, the impurities blocked in the screen 31 can be brushed out, after cleaning, repeat the above operations.

清洁刷32不仅可以用来清除筛网31中的杂质,还可以用来清洁筛网31,滑槽34上端的收纳槽35在振动筛工作时可将清洁刷32抬高,使清洁刷32下端脱离筛网31,避免清洁刷32影响物料向出料斗33方向流动;挡料板可防止振动筛工作过程中物料从滑槽34内流出;当清洁刷32磨损时,可将清洁刷32两端的挡块321拆下,然后更换新的清洁刷32。The cleaning brush 32 can not only be used to remove impurities in the screen cloth 31, but also can be used to clean the screen cloth 31. The storage groove 35 at the upper end of the chute 34 can raise the cleaning brush 32 when the vibrating screen is working, so that the cleaning brush 32 lower end Break away from the screen 31 to prevent the cleaning brush 32 from affecting the flow of materials to the discharge hopper 33; the baffle plate can prevent the material from flowing out of the chute 34 during the working process of the vibrating screen; when the cleaning brush 32 is worn, the two ends of the cleaning brush 32 can be removed The stopper 321 is removed, and then a new cleaning brush 32 is replaced.
